All Packages  Class Hierarchy  This Package  Previous  Next  Index

Class ejem02.RectApplet

java.lang.Object
   |
   +----java.awt.Component
           |
           +----java.awt.Container
                   |
                   +----java.awt.Panel
                           |
                           +----java.applet.Applet
                                   |
                                   +----ejem02.RectApplet

public class RectApplet
extends Applet
implements ActionListener
Dibuja en un applet, un rectangulo que se puede mover horizontal y verticalmente


Constructor Index

 o RectApplet()

Method Index

 o actionPerformed(ActionEvent)
Escucha a los botones.
 o down()
 o init()
Cambia el color de fondo.
 o left()
Mueve el rectangulo.
 o paint(Graphics)
Dibuja el rectangulo en el centro.
 o redraw()
 o right()
 o setColor(int, int, int)
Cambia el color del rectangulo.
 o start()
Crea el rectangulo en el centro (40 x 20).
 o swap()
Intercambia la base y la altura.
 o up()

Constructors

 o RectApplet
 public RectApplet()

Methods

 o left
 public void left()
Mueve el rectangulo.

 o right
 public void right()
 o up
 public void up()
 o down
 public void down()
 o swap
 public void swap()
Intercambia la base y la altura.

 o redraw
 public void redraw()
 o setColor
 public void setColor(int r,
                      int g,
                      int b)
Cambia el color del rectangulo.

 o init
 public void init()
Cambia el color de fondo. Abajo pone los botones. Escucha los eventos

Overrides:
init in class Applet
 o start
 public void start()
Crea el rectangulo en el centro (40 x 20).

Overrides:
start in class Applet
 o actionPerformed
 public void actionPerformed(ActionEvent e)
Escucha a los botones.

 o paint
 public void paint(Graphics g)
Dibuja el rectangulo en el centro.

Overrides:
paint in class Container

All Packages  Class Hierarchy  This Package  Previous  Next  Index